4 Safety and efficiency Protecting patients and caregivers, and helping deliver care faster with fewer people Surface illustration Our pressure redistribution surface with low-airloss therapy distributes load over the contact areas of the body, helping to minimize tissue damage and reduce the risk of pressure ulcers. Using the patient s weight, the air system automatically adjusts the pressures specifically for that patient. Opti-Rest provides a soothing, wave-like comfort modality that continues to provide pressure redistribution. Max Inflate firms the surface quickly for enhanced patient handling. The low airloss surface makes it easy to administer continuous lateral rotation therapy (CLRT) and percussion/vibration therapy at a touch of a button. Our multilayered foam surface also provides special protection. The multilayered foam surface has a soft top layer for patient comfort and a supportive bottom layer. The surface also provides special protection for the heel area with its expandable visco elastic foam. This foam surface is designed to provide pressure redistribution in all bed positions, including FullChair positioning.
5 Fast, efficient transport. With IntelliDrive Powered Transport, even one caregiver can transport your bariatric patient. Easier routine care. Turn Assist uses the bed s pressure relief surface to help turn the patient, making it easier and safer to perform linen changes and other routine tasks. No more tugging and pulling. The FlexAfootTM retractable foot mechanism allows the bed system to be customized to the patient s height, minimizing sliding down in bed. FullChair position with cradle transition gently supports the bariatric patient to minimize sliding during FullChair positioning (not pictured).
6 Mobility and dignity Getting patients moving throughout their stay, and preserving their dignity at every turn From in bed The single post patient-helper trapeze allows patients to reposition themselves in bed. Designed for safety, it locks in the central position. The FlexAfootTM retractable foot mechanism allows the bed system to be customized to the patient s height. Continuous lateral rotation therapy (CLRT) and percussion/vibration therapy can easily be administered to help clear secretions from the lungs. To up in chair FullChair position provides the benefits of up in chair without moving the patient. Because the frame and surface are integrated, FullChair positioning is achieved with just the touch of a button. This feature minimizes the risk of injury to the patient and the caregiver. Cradle Transition provides improved support for larger patients as they move into the FullChair position.
7 To standing up Seat deflate gently lowers the patient to a safe distance from the floor. Chair Egress permits safer, easier patient egress, both front and side, with less risk of injury for caregivers.
8 Technical specifications Overall Bed height Low Position - sleep deck to the floor...19" (48.2 cm) High Position - sleep deck to the floor...38" (94.0 cm) Low Position* - top of air surface to the floor " (54.6 cm) * with seat deflate High Position - top of air surface to the floor...49" (124.5 cm) Headboard/push handles maintain same height regardless of patient surface height...yes Sleep Surface Available Configurations Surface thickness Foam...8" (20.3 cm) Surface thickness Air...11" (27.9 cm) Surface thickness Air with pulmonary...11" (27.9 cm) Width...40" (102 cm) Length, fully extended...84" (213.4 cm) Length, fully retracted...72" (182.7 cm) Overall Bed width Siderails stowed...40" (102 cm) Siderails up...42" (106.6 cm) Overall Bed length Fully extended " (237.3 cm) Fully retracted " (206.8 cm) Bed angles Head and trend angle indicators...yes Head section Knee gatch Max trend/reverse trend...15 /15 Chair position Head Seat Foot Thigh...10 Egress position Head Seat Foot Thigh...10 Caster & braking system Optional IntelliDrive power transport...yes Caster diameter...5" (12.7 cm) with IntelliDrive power transport...6" (15.2 cm) Four-wheel braking...yes Brakes lock both rolling and swiveling...yes Optional scale system Accuracy...1% of patient weight Weigh in any position (except Trend/Rev Trend)...Yes Scale weight capacity lbs (227 kg) Patient controls Siderail patient bed controls...standard Pendant...Standard SideCom patient communication controls - capital purchase only (Nurse call, universal TV/radio, and lighting)...optional Patient Helper Height Floor to top of patient helper " (207 cm) Weight Limit (safe working load) lbs (250 kg) Weight Limit (patient capacity) lbs-500 lbs (227 kg) Safety Listing...UL Electrical characteristics Power requirements...120v, 60 cycle AC Fuse...15A Maximum current...9.9a Fire Safety Meets the requirements of...16cfr1632 Foam and air surface meet...cal129, CAL603, NFPA101, BFDIX-11 Hill-Rom reserves the right to make changes without notice in design, specifications and models.
